    The cargo basket will mount to the MOLLE panels. We did have a discussion about the possibility of a mounting system without the MOLLE panels but decided against it for several reasons. The basket gains a lot of strength from the top mounting points of the MOLLE panels. They allow for extra storage space and protect the windows from gear in the basket itself, and without the panels, a lot more bracing/brackets would be required to support it, increasing the price.

    The basket its all-aluminum, weighs about 26lbs. The mounting points are holding up great. You will need to be conscious of the amount of weight you add when bouncing around offroad.

    Designed to maximize space in the rear cargo area. Mounts at the height of the rear seatbacks to allow for an unobstructed view when unloaded. There is about 22" from the floor to the bottom of the basket, enough room for a fridge with a slide.

    • Bolt together assembly
    • Coated in a 2 stage satin textured black powder coat
    • Includes assembly and mounting hardware
    • Includes tie-down points
    • Requires two Rear Window MOLLE Panels to mount
    • Made from .125" aluminum with extruded aluminum rails
